Brookhaven Peachtree Coridor Alliance (BPCA)
Sept 2012
This group of civic volunteers has done an outstanding job of working with developers & zoning issues to facilitate smart growth within Brookhaven. Their website, www.abetterbrookhaven.org, is a tremendous resource for citizens interested in zoning issues and developments "in the pipeline" particurlarly around the Brookhaven Overlay District.
